University of Fredericton(UFred) is a private, government-approved online university in Canada, founded in 2005. The page highlights UFred as one of the earlier Canadian universities to develop online education, offering undergraduate, graduate, and certificate programs. Its positioning is to provide a flexible and relatively affordable online education pathway for people who cannot attend traditional in-person classes.

Regarding faculty, UFred emphasizes that its instructors meet high academic standards, have an average of over 15 years of teaching experience, and support students in a mentor-like role. Institutional figures include over 20 years of online education experience, 12K+ alumni and program graduates, and 5K+ current students, suggesting a relatively mature online education operation.

Its main advantage is the fully online design, which is better suited to working professionals and learners studying from different locations. The programs emphasize involvement from industry experts, labor-market demand, and practical application. The online community and student support are also presented as key selling points. The limitations are that the available information lacks a program list, pricing, program duration, course language, specific teaching format, and details on services for international students, making it difficult to fully assess the learning experience and return on investment.
UFred is better suited to people who want to earn a Canadian university degree or certificate online, need to balance work and life, and are focused on career advancement.
